Hey guys, I'm just wondering if any of you may have some advice about what companies I can apply for since I have no experience and It's really hard to get a job.
I graduated about 2 months ago from a trucking school in San Jose,CA, I have a couple of endorsements but not much experience on the road. So,if anyone knows or has a list of companies that will hire students, I would greatly appreciate it. Thanks for your feedback:thumbsup:

Who's hiring new inexperienced drivers? Nobody! There are plenty of experienced veterans having trouble finding a driving job. Go to all the usual suspects Swift, CR England, Central, Prime, Schneider, Watkins Shepard, Werner, US Xpress, Covenant, Gordon, etc.
